Mrs. Bobbie Jean
Brundidge-Flowers
April 7, 1946 – May 28, 2026
Mrs. Bobbie Jean Brundidge Flowers was born on April 7, 1946, in Goshen, Alabama, to the late Willie James Brundidge and Mary Lee Youngblood. She later moved to Troy, Alabama, where she was educated in the local school system and graduated from Academy Street High School in 1964.
Bobbie gave her life to Christ at an early age and remained a faithful servant throughout her life. She dedicated her time and talents to the church, serving as an usher, working with the youth ministry, and assisting in the kitchen ministry in her younger years. She was a devoted member of Mt. Zion Baptist Church, where she faithfully worshiped under the leadership of Rev. Daniel Simmons.
On Thursday, May 28, 2026, Bobbie peacefully entered into her eternal rest in the arms of Jesus.
She was preceeded in death by two sisters: Caretha Brundidge and Jessie Mae Brantley. Brothers and Sisters-in-law: Mark (Willie Mae) Bacon, Lucille (Matthew) Brown, Louise (Benny) Wilson, Doris (Jonas) Corbin, Annie Lois (John) Hall, Annie Willie Flowers, William Flowers, and Solomon (Stella) Flowers.
She leaves to cherish her loving memory: her devoted husband, Roger Flowers; her children, Reginald (Mia) Flowers and Pamela Theresa Flowers; her beloved grandchildren, Patrice Lachell Lee, LaMia Elayne (Paul) Sherman, Reginald Makel Flowers, and Ryan Mekhi Flowers; and her cherished great-grandson, K’syn Sherman.
She is also survived by her sisters and brother, Mary Jean (James) Pope, Viola (Willie Mack) Levens, and Willie Cee Youngblood; her sisters-in-law and brothers-in-law, Margie Flowers, Wallace (Mary) Flowers, Charles (Elaine) Flowers, Gloria (Wilbur) McAfee, and Horace (Yvonne) Flowers; along with a host of nieces, nephews, cousins, other relatives, and dear friends who will forever cherish her memory.
